Macy's Canada, Aye?

On the international front, overseas developers are all over Macy’s, eager to get the company to open Macy’s and Bloomingdale’s outside the U.S. So far, Macy’s Inc. has only one international store, Bloomingdale’s in Dubai, though Macy’s does distribute a small volume of merchandise to about 100 primarily English-speaking countries.

Asked if Sears unloading units in Canada could present an opportunity, Lundgren replied, “It could.” But he added, “You’ve got to look at a big picture strategy” before considering stores here and there. Nordstrom is also eyeing Canada, and may be considering some Sears locations there.


On May 22, Macy’s officially launches its Brazil promotion, though there is Brazilian merchandise already selling in the stores. Asked if import promotions are on the agenda for the future, Lundgren said, “We want to see the results for Brazil.…We’re not going to commit to one every year.”
